Offer Description
We are seeking to recruit a researcher (with PhD) for the YOUth project Debunking the gendered Arguments of faro-Right Extremism YOU-DARE (2025-2028), HORIZON-CL2-2024-DEMOCRACY-01-05 European Commission of the Arts and Humanities Studies.
The aim of the project is, through an interdisciplinary and participatory approach, to dissect the gendered foundations of far-right youth groups by examining the roles of youth leaders and the digital platforms that amplify their messages. The project offers a detailed evidence-based insights on the democratic challenges posed by these movements and proposes targeted strategies for intervention, policy approaches and pratical tools for policymakers and practitioners to address the underlying roots of violent, discriminatory and illiberal political discourse in online spaces.
